My C8 Pro is out for delivery (under 48 hours from Arizona to Teesside - pretty good ), I've had a look the docs for migration but have a couple of queries before I begin later:
Edit: It's been delivered - 42 hours Arizona > North Yorkshire
1 - My C8 is in the beta group. I assume that before I restore the C8 Pro from the migration backup, I'll want to get the Pro on the same version. I guess I'll need to power up the C8 Pro, get the hub ID and post a request to get it enrolled in the beta program. Who's the best person to tag for that request, as there'll be a period while I'm waiting for that when I'll need to keep the old hub running too?
Edit - I've registered the new hub to my account john.**.*******on@icloud.com. @bobbyD can someone please add it to the beta group
2 - Zigbee Channel. Does the migration backup contain the channel setting for the Zigbee radio? If not, I'll want to set that on the Pro before I restore the migration backup to ensure the same channel is used and doesn't conflict with my Hue setup.
Edit - I've set the channel manually the same as the previous hub
3 - Z Wave Z-IP or JS. By default what will the Z Wave stack be? As my C8 is on Z-IP I don't want it to be on JS after restoring the migration backup. If the default is JS do I need to switch to Z-IP before restoring the migration backup?
Edit - Confirmed that the hub comes set on Z-IP
4 - Should I expect shenanigans with integrations using maker api? (external dashboards, node-red amongst others) Will I need amend token IDs in connected services? I assume these will be different even after restoring the backup.
I'm sure something else will come to mind and blindside me.....
You can downgrade your existing hub to a non-beta version and proceed that way. You can then have the new hub enrolled in beta after. You just want both hubs to be on the same version before migrating. It's totally your call on how you want to proceed.
I'll wait for beta on the new one, as I'm using and testing current beta features "I could tell you, but then I'd have to kill you. What happens in beta stays in beta" - Though your tag would suggest you're also in beta
So, for clarification, will links to the original hub maker API still work? (the same access tokens carry over?) I thought the new hub created new access tokens you need for maker API. This has been a major factor in my delay in upgrading as I use several tasker integrations that rely on get requests to maker API.
Right - new hub is enrolled in beta and updated. It's game time
Migration backup is done - a bit strange as when I go into Cloud Backups > Migration Ready Backups on the C8 it does not show, however it does show on the C8 Pro. I'm not sure if that's how it's supposed to work but it does cause a bit of confusion....
3rd party dashboards and integrations working (mostly)
To resolve:
Zigbee showing the 'weak channel' warning despite being set exactly as the previous hub (which is now powered down) and the hub is in the precise same location
Apple Home. I use Homebridge. Most devices working but a few not playing (Harmony activities working from device menu but not updating on Apple) - Fixed with Homebridge restart.
Apple Shortcut not working Fixed after editing shortcut - needed to match it to the new url in maker api
I believe that is by design, so you can't use it as a "free" single cloud backup on the same hub. When I got a warranty replacement C8, I had to buy cloud backup to do a full radio migration from bad C8-> new C8.